SANTA ANA GLOBAL ENTERPRISES, S (STNA) — Cash Flow-to-Debt Ratio

Latest as of July 2025: -0.28x

SANTA ANA GLOBAL ENTERPRISES, S (STNA) has a Cash Flow-to-Debt Ratio of -0.28x as of July 2025, meaning its operating cash flow of €-2.16 Million could theoretically repay 0% of its total liabilities (€7.67 Million) in one year. Year CF-to-Debt Ratio Operating CF (EUR) Total Liabilities YoY Change
2025 -0.28x €-2.16 Million €7.67 Million ▼ -60.6%
2024 -0.18x €-1.11 Million €6.36 Million
Cash Flow-to-Debt Ratio = Operating Cash Flow / Total Liabilities. Higher is better for debt service capacity.
